Ancient Beginnings of Gambling
The roots of gambling can be traced back to ancient civilizations, where games of chance were often intertwined with social rituals and daily life. Archaeological findings suggest that the Chinese were playing games of chance as early as 2300 BC, utilizing rudimentary dice made from animal bones. Similarly, ancient Egyptians enjoyed gambling through various forms of dice and board games, often linking these activities to their spiritual beliefs and practices. These early examples highlight how gambling served not just as entertainment but also as a means of social bonding and cultural expression. The Greeks contributed significantly to the history of gambling with their own games involving betting. They introduced board games and other betting activities that reflected their love for competition and chance. The Romans, too, embraced gambling, incorporating it into their festivals and public events. Notably, the Romans had organized games in which participants could wager on various outcomes, including the famous gladiatorial contests. This structured form of betting paved the way for the more formalized gambling establishments that would emerge in later centuries.
As civilizations evolved, so did the methods and tools used in gambling. The introduction of cards in the 9th century in China marked a significant turning point, leading to the development of various card games that spread throughout the world. This era laid the groundwork for the rise of gambling houses and ultimately, the casinos we recognize today. The social and cultural significance of gambling continued to grow, influencing art, literature, and community events throughout history.
The Rise of Formal Gambling Establishments
The evolution of gambling saw a major shift in the 17th century with the establishment of the first official casinos in Europe. The Ridotto, opened in Venice in 1638, is often considered the world’s first casino. Designed for the nobility, this establishment offered a regulated environment for gambling and set the precedent for future casinos. The concept of a dedicated space for gambling allowed for better management of games and the assurance of fairness, which attracted a broader clientele beyond just the elite.
During this period, gambling began to attract attention from governments, leading to the establishment of regulations aimed at curbing illegal betting practices. In France, casinos flourished alongside the popularity of games such as baccarat and chemin de fer. The notion of a regulated gambling house became increasingly popular across Europe, with cities like Monte Carlo soon becoming synonymous with luxury and high-stakes gaming.
The 19th century saw further expansion of casinos, particularly in the United States. The Gold Rush era brought a surge of settlers and miners to the West, leading to the establishment of gambling houses in burgeoning towns. These establishments catered to the desires of miners seeking entertainment and opportunity, reflecting the adventurous spirit of the time. This marked the beginning of a more accessible gambling culture in America, paving the way for Las Vegas and other gaming hubs.
The Golden Age of Las Vegas
The mid-20th century heralded a new era in the history of casinos, with Las Vegas emerging as the epicenter of gambling in the United States. Following the end of Prohibition in 1933, Nevada legalized gambling, setting the stage for an unprecedented explosion of casino growth. Iconic establishments such as The Flamingo, founded by mobster Bugsy Siegel, opened their doors and transformed the landscape of entertainment. Las Vegas quickly became a playground for adults, combining luxury, entertainment, and gaming in a way that had never been seen before.
The marketing and allure of Las Vegas casinos relied heavily on glamour, celebrity performances, and extravagant shows. The introduction of themed resorts, such as Caesar’s Palace and The Venetian, attracted visitors from around the world. These establishments were not merely gambling venues; they were entire experiences that included dining, shopping, and entertainment options. This multifaceted approach solidified Las Vegas’s reputation as the ultimate destination for those seeking excitement and indulgence.
As technology advanced, casinos began adopting more innovative practices, including the introduction of slot machines and electronic gaming. The development of these machines not only simplified the gaming experience for players but also increased profitability for casinos. The evolution of online gambling in the late 1990s marked a further transformation, allowing players to experience casino gaming from the comfort of their homes, expanding the reach of gambling culture beyond physical locations.
The Impact of Technology on Modern Gambling
The advent of the internet revolutionized the casino landscape, allowing online gaming to flourish in the 21st century. Players gained unprecedented access to a variety of games, from traditional table games to innovative slots, all available at their fingertips. With the rise of online casinos, players enjoyed the convenience of gaming without geographical limitations, which resulted in a dramatic increase in the gambling population. This shift also created competition among casinos to offer the best user experience, bonuses, and promotions.
As mobile technology progressed, the development of casino apps further transformed the gambling experience. Players could now gamble anytime, anywhere, leading to the rise of mobile gaming. This convenience appealed particularly to younger generations who sought instant gratification and engaging experiences. Additionally, advancements in technology allowed for live dealer games, where players could enjoy the atmosphere of a traditional casino while interacting with real dealers via streaming.

Exploring the Future of Casinos
The future of casinos is poised for further innovation as technology continues to advance.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are beginning to make their mark on the gambling industry, offering players an immersive experience that simulates a physical casino environment. These technologies can provide unique interactions and engaging gameplay, potentially attracting a broader audience interested in a more interactive gambling experience.
Moreover, adv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) are enhancing customer service and personalizing player experiences. Casinos are using AI to analyze player behavior, preferences, and spending patterns to tailor marketing efforts and game offerings. This personalization can create more engaging environments for players, increasing retention and customer satisfaction.
As the landscape of gambling continues to evolve, it is crucial to address responsible gaming practices. With the rise of online gambling, concerns about addiction and responsible gaming have surfaced. Many casinos are implementing measures to promote responsible gambling, including self-exclusion programs and educational resources. The balance between innovation and responsible gaming will be critical for the long-term sustainability of the casino industry.
